CCM 5.X, Unity 4.2 Unified Messaging, MGCP Gateways,
 
How can I send unconfigured DID's to an auto-attendant.
 
The customer has a block of numbers (xxx) XXX-1000 through 2000.  But
only 200 of the DID's are in use.  Right now if someone dials a number
that is not in use, the caller gets a re-order tone (fast busy).  How
can I forward those (in bulk) to the Auto-Attendant without configuring
CTI Route points for each DID?
 
I suspect that a CTI Route Point with a number of "XXXX" should do the
trick, but I haven't tested.  
 
Has anyone done this before?
